Summary:
Basis DC PCS is the sole high school located in the Basis DC PCS district, serving grades 5-12 with a total enrollment of 690 students. This public charter school has consistently been ranked among the top 3 high schools in Washington, D.C., maintaining a 5-star rating from SchoolDigger for the past three school years.
Basis DC PCS stands out for its exceptional academic performance, with students demonstrating significantly higher proficiency rates compared to the district average across various subjects and grade levels. In the 2024-2025 school year, 77.9% of Basis DC PCS students were proficient or better in English Language Arts, compared to the district average of 37.6%, and 67.7% were proficient or better in Mathematics, compared to the district average of 26.4%. The school has maintained consistent academic growth, with improvements or high proficiency rates in both English Language Arts and Mathematics over the past three years.
Basis DC PCS offers a range of End-of-Course exams, indicating a comprehensive academic program, and has a relatively low student-teacher ratio of 13.3 and a higher spending per student of $17,412 compared to the district average. These factors may contribute to the school's exceptional performance, though further investigation into the school's teaching practices, curriculum, and other resources could provide additional insights into the factors behind its success.
